The school board of any school district may issue capital outlay certificates to acquire or construct real property, plant, or equipment. All capital outlay certificates shall be authorized, issued, and sold in accordance with the provisions of chapter 6-8B. However, no election other than as provided in §§ 13-16-6.3 and 13-16-6.4 may be held, and the certificates may not have a maturity date in excess of twenty years from the date of issuance.
S.D. Codified Laws § 13-16-6.2
Capital outlay certificates authorized--Issuance--Sale--Election--Maturity
Source: SDCL, §§ 13-16-6, 13-16-6.1, as enacted by SL 1978, ch 109, §§ 1, 2; SL 1984, ch 43, § 102B; SL 1988, ch 140, § 4.
